    Abstract: A fluid filter assembly is adapted to filter out contaminants from a fluid supply. The filter assembly includes a housing that is adapted to house a cylindrical filter element. The housing includes a lower housing and an upper housing. A top plate is secured to the upper filter housing. Both the top plate and upper filter housing include seals that are adapted to seal the filter. The filter includes threads formed on an exterior surface of the upper housing to allow the filter to be coupled to a filter mount. Dirty fuel enters the filter through the top plate by use of a plurality of openings formed in the top plate, passes through media of the filter element, and exits through a center opening formed in the top plate.

    Abstract: A filter for filtering contaminants from a fluid. The filter includes a cylinder of pleated filter media, a first end cap coupled to a first end of the filter media and a second end cap coupled to a second end of the filter media. The second end cap including a wall formed to include a central opening. The filter also includes a central core positioned radially inward of filter media and extends from the first end cap to the second end cap. The central core has a cylindrical side wall that is formed to include a plurality of apertures that are adapted to allow for the passage of the fluid. The filter also includes an annular collar that is adapted to be positioned within the central core. The annular collar is adapted to be rotatable with respect to the central core and includes a sidewall formed to include a series of space projections that extend radially inwardly from the sidewall.

    Abstract: A filter assembly has a housing open at one end, with an annular filter media/core assembly disposed in the housing. An end plate having at least two inlet openings and an outlet opening is disposed in the open end of the housing. The end plate is affixed to a lid which is secured to the end of the housing. A combination valve is retained between the filter media/core assembly and the end plate. The combination valve has a first portion that cooperates with the first inlet opening in the end plate and a second portion cooperating with the second inlet opening. In use fluid will pass through the first inlet opening, the filter media/core assembly and be discharged from the housing through the outlet opening.

    Abstract: A fuel dispenser filter for filtering fuel is adapted to be connected to a support in a fuel distribution system. The filter comprises a housing including an adaptor constructed and arranged to be secured to the support and a bowl operatively connected to the adaptor. A stud/spacer is secured in the adaptor. The stud/spacer defines a centrally disposed outlet flow passage and outwardly disposed inlet flow passages. A sleeve member is movably supported in the adaptor between the stud/spacer and the adaptor. The sleeve member is constructed and arranged to open and close the fuel flow through the inlet flow passages. A filter assembly including filter media is provided in the bowl for filtering the fuel passing through the filter. When the bowl is firmly engaged with the adaptor, the sleeve member is moved to open position to permit the flow of fuel through the filter and when the bowl is removed from the adaptor, the sleeve member is moved to a closed position to stop the flow of fuel.

    Abstract: The dual element water sensing fuel dispenser filter comprises a housing with an open end. An end plate is positioned in the open end. Contained within the housing is a filter element assembly that includes a first filter portion and a second filter portion. The first filter portion is formed from an annular pleated paper filter media comprised of two layers with a water sensing chemical therebetween. Disposed within the pleated paper filter media are a pair of generally concentric perforate cores containing a chemical fill therebetween. The pleated paper filter media will remove particulate matter from the fuel, whether the fuel be gasoline or an alcohol-gasoline blended fuel. The water sensing chemical in the pleated paper filter media will sense and remove water from the gasoline fuel. The chemical fill will sense the phase separation in the alcohol-gasoline blended fuel and will swell and gell to preclude water from passing through the filter.

    Abstract: An oil filter includes a housing 14 having an end plate 20 attached to the open end thereof. The end plate 20 includes an outlet opening and inlet openings 22. An anti-drainback valve 49 is provided adjacent the end plate. A filter element having an end cap at each end is positioned within the housing. The end cap 50 remote from the end plate includes a plurality of openings 52 spaced from a closed central portion 51. A spring valve 60 cooperates with the end cap 50 and the interior wall of the housing to alternately allow and disallow oil flow through the end cap openings depending upon the differential pressure across the end cap 50. The spring valve 60 and the end cap 50 can be operationally interengage to provide a relatively flat profile. Depressions 72 (FIG. 5) may be included between the arms 62 of the spring valve to provide a flow path should the spring valve be flattened against the housing during operation of the filter.

    Abstract: A thermal sensitive material 61 is disposed between a spring valve 60 and an end cap 50 of an oil filter (FIG. 1). Upon reaching a predetermined pressure, e.g. when the media of the oil filter becomes clogged, an opening 52 in the end cap opens to allow the oil to bypass the filter media. However, the thermal sensitive material precludes bypass flow through the end cap (e.g. during initial operation of the engine when a pressure surge may occur) until a predetermined oil temperature is attained.
